         <description><![CDATA[<div>Today our class will be looking at the primary colors. During this lesson we will look at what colors they are and what happens to them when mixed in a group activity. The class will be engaged and able to interact with the entire lesson.   As a group we will find out, discuss and watch videos about the primary colors. The class will also participate in 2 group activities that will allow the children to come familiar with the 3 colors and see how to mix them correctly to make the secondary colors. First will be to fill out the 3 colors on a basic color wheel. There will also be places for the secondary colors in between the correct primary colors to fill out during the next activity. Please help the children with this step. The best thing to do would be giving them one color and working with them with each color.
